Mail Systems Engineer at CloudLinux
Job Description
About CloudLinux and Imunify Email
CloudLinux is a global, remote-first company delivering Linux infrastructure and security products that help organisations improve operational efficiency. Imunify Email, part of the Imunify360 family, provides high-performance email protection for hosting providers, focusing on spam detection, deliverability, and infrastructure protection. Learn more at https://imunify360.com/ and https://cloudlinux.com/.
Role overview
We are seeking a Mail Systems Engineer to join the Imunify Email team. You will work on large-scale mail infrastructure, improving mail deliverability and protection, and automating production workflows. This role requires deep Postfix or Exim expertise, strong Linux skills, and experience running and tuning mail clusters and SMTP systems. The position is fully remote and can be performed from anywhere worldwide.
Key responsibilities
- Operate and optimise large-scale mail clusters and SMTP infrastructures.
- Design and implement solutions for spam detection, outbound traffic hygiene, and IP reputation preservation.
- Develop and maintain tools and automations for monitoring CVEs, applying patches, and validating mail system behaviour.
- Build and maintain reliable, performant mail processing pipelines and SQL-backed data workflows.
- Collaborate with product, security, and engineering teams to deploy and support production services.
- Create and maintain documentation, tests, and runbooks for mail operations and incident response.
Requirements
- Expert-level experience with Postfix or Exim and deep SMTP protocol knowledge.
- Strong proficiency with GNU/Linux systems and shell scripting.
- Experience operating large-scale clusters and understanding of mail deliverability and reputation mechanics.
- Solid SQL skills for designing and optimising data processing queries.
- 3+ years of relevant professional experience, with strong problem solving and communication skills.
- English proficiency at upper-intermediate level or higher.
Nice to have
- Scripting experience in Python, Bash, or Perl for automation and tooling.
- Familiarity with SPF, DKIM, DMARC, and mail security standards.
- Experience with containerisation or cloud deployments related to mail systems.
- Knowledge of C or low-level system integration for advanced debugging.
Personal qualities
- Proactive, fast learner with strong prioritisation and independent decision making.
- Team-oriented and able to work remotely across time zones.
- Comfortable analysing ambiguous problems and delivering pragmatic solutions.
Benefits
- Fully remote work with flexible working hours, work from any location worldwide.
- Paid 24 days of vacation per year, 10 national holidays, and unlimited sick leave.
- Compensation or reimbursement for private medical insurance.
- Co-working and gym or sports reimbursement.
- Budget for education and professional development.
